Jammu and Kashmir registered five new covid-19 cases while there was no death due to it in the last 24 hours, officials said on Monday.

They said that four of the cases were reported from Kashmir Valley, three from Srinagar and one from Kupwara while one was Jammu. The fresh cases take the total tally to 453946, 166281 in Jammu and 287665 in Kashmir.

There was no death reported in the last 24 hours, they said. So far 4751 persons have succumbed to the virus, 2328 in Jammu and 2423 in Kashmir.

Besides, they said, 13 Covid-19 patients recovered during the time, all from the Valley. So far 449128 people have recovered, leaving the active case tally at 67, 7 in Jammu and 60 in Kashmir.

The officials said there was no new confirmed case of mucormycosis (black fungus) reported today. So far 51 black fungus cases have been confirmed in J-K, the officials said. They also informed that 21183 doses of covid-19 vaccine were administered during the time in J-K. (GNS)
